Fiber Laser Buying Tips: Features, Power, & More

Selecting a appropriate fiber beam can feel overwhelming, but understanding key factors simplifies the process. First, evaluate the planned application; several tasks require diverse power stages. Lower wattages, typically ranging 10-50W, operate well for marking delicate substances like plastics or slender metals. Higher power choices, 50W and beyond, are vital for slicing thicker stock. Outside power, review the beam's wavelength; typical wavelengths include 1064nm, but specialized materials may benefit from other wavelengths.

Finally, thorough investigation ensures a intelligent fiber beam purchase.
